Five Important Things to Do When Building a Home

Building a brand-new custom home can be a daunting undertaking, as there are so many factors that must be considered from start to finish. Fortunately, your local custom home builders in Tyler, TX are here to tell you about five important things to keep in mind as you get ready to start building your future home:

  • Know what you are getting into: While no one expects building a home from the ground up to be easy, many aren’t aware of just how all-consuming the project will be. You will have to spend a great deal of time designing your future home, and once construction starts, even more time will be dedicated to visiting the site frequently. If you already have a lot going on in your day-to-day life, keep all of this in mind as you plan the best time to begin building.
  • Choose your team wisely: While you will still want to check in on your new home construction as often as you can, working with the right team can give you peace of mind that everything is going as it should when you aren’t there. You will be spending a lot of time with this group, and they will be responsible for making sure that your dream home is exactly as you want it to be, so choosing someone that you trust and feel comfortable with is imperative.
  • Plan ahead: It might be some time before you are ready to start moving furniture into your new home, but having a general idea of what you want ahead of time will be helpful. If you know the sizes and shapes of the furnishings you want to add before it is too late, it is possible that adjustments can still be made to the floorplan to accommodate any changes if necessary. However, the further along the construction is, the more difficult and expensive these changes will be.
  • Communicate thoroughly: Communicate everything you want as clearly as possible, and if necessary snap a photo or take a picture out of a magazine so you can present the closest visual image of what you are looking for. You can never assume that the team working on your house knows exactly what you need, so be sure to provide as many details as you can think of throughout the entire process.
  • Trust your gut: You should trust the professionals you have hired, but if your gut is telling you there is a modification that you feel absolutely needs to be a part of your home, don’t be afraid to speak up and ask if it is possible.

Above all, don’t forget to enjoy the process of building your own home. There will be times when things become overwhelming, but working towards your end goal with a great team will give you confidence in the future.
